The University of Arkansas at Little Rock H1B Salaries

The University of Arkansas at Little Rock H-1B salary data for all visa-sponsored positions, from Labor Condition Applications (LCAs) filed with the Department of Labor. H-1B employers must pay the higher of the actual wage or the prevailing wage for the occupation and area of employment.

Frequently Asked Questions

The University of Arkansas at Little Rock pays a median H-1B salary of $58,025 for sponsored positions, with an average of $64,751. The average prevailing wage across The University of Arkansas at Little Rock's filings is $48,941. These figures are based on Labor Condition Application filings with the Department of Labor.
